Лепшы адказ: Як сартаваць вялікія файлы ў Linux?

Як сартаваць вялікія файлы?

Адзіны прыдатны варыянт для эфектыўнай сартавання вельмі вялікіх файлаў каб падзяліць іх, адсартуйце асобныя часткі паралельна і аб'яднайце іх. Гэта разбівае ўваходны файл на кавалкі па 100000 XNUMX радкоў.

Як сартаваць файлы па памеры ў Unix?

Каб пералічыць усе файлы і адсартаваць іх па памеры, выкарыстоўвайце опцыю -S. Па змаўчанні ён адлюстроўвае высновы ў парадку змяншэння (памер ад найбольшага да найменшага). Вы можаце вывесці памеры файлаў у фармаце, які чытаецца чалавекам, дадаўшы опцыю -h, як паказана на малюнку. А каб сартаваць у зваротным парадку, дадайце сцяг -r наступным чынам.

Як вы сартуеце файлы ў Linux?

Як адсартаваць файлы ў Linux з дапамогай каманды Sort

  1. Выканайце лікавае сартаванне, выкарыстоўваючы опцыю -n. …
  2. Адсартуйце чытэльныя лічбы з дапамогай опцыі -h. …
  3. Сартуйце месяцы года з дапамогай опцыі -M. …
  4. Праверце, ці змесціва ўжо адсартавана, выкарыстоўваючы опцыю -c. …
  5. Зменіце вывад і праверце ўнікальнасць з дапамогай опцый -r і -u.

Дзе знаходзяцца 10 самых вялікіх файлаў у Linux?

Каманда, каб знайсці 10 самых вялікіх файлаў у Linux

  1. Каманда дзю -h варыянт: памер дысплея файла ў лёгкачытальным фармаце, у кілабайтах, мегабайтах і гігабайтах.
  2. Дзю камандавання -s опцыя: Паказваць вынік для кожнага аргументу.
  3. du command -x option : прапусціць каталогі. …
  4. сартаваць каманду параметр -r: зваротны вынік параўнання.

Як сартаваць вялікі масіў?

Як адсартаваць вялікі масіў з вялікай колькасцю паўтораў?

  1. Стварыце пустое дрэва AVL з падлікам у якасці дадатковага поля.
  2. Перайдзіце па масіве ўводу і зрабіце наступнае для кожнага элемента 'arr[i]' …..a) Калі arr[i] не прысутнічае ў дрэве, устаўце яго і ініцыялізуйце лік як 1. …
  3. Выканайце абыход дрэва ў парадку.

Як сартаваць файлы памерам 10 ГБ?

Для сартавання 10 ГБ дадзеных з выкарыстаннем толькі 1 ГБ аператыўнай памяці:

  1. Счытайце 1 ГБ дадзеных у асноўнай памяці і адсартуйце з дапамогай хуткай сартавання.
  2. Запіс адсартаваных даных на дыск.
  3. Паўтарайце крокі 1 і 2, пакуль усе даныя не будуць адсартаваныя кавалкамі памерам 1 ГБ (ёсць 10 ГБ / 1 ГБ = 10 фрагментаў), якія цяпер трэба аб'яднаць у адзіны выходны файл.

Як знайсці 10 лепшых вялікіх файлаў у Unix?

Linux знаходзіць самы вялікі файл у каталогу рэкурсіўна з дапамогай find

  1. Адкрыйце прыкладанне тэрмінала.
  2. Увайдзіце як карыстальнік root з дапамогай каманды sudo -i.
  3. Увядзіце du -a /dir/ | сартаваць -n -r | галава -n 20.
  4. du ацэніць выкарыстанне файлавай прасторы.
  5. sort будзе сартаваць вынік каманды du.
  6. галава пакажа толькі 20 самых вялікіх файлаў у /dir/

Як сартаваць файлы па імені ў Linux?

Калі вы дадасце опцыю -X, ls будзе сартаваць файлы па імені ў кожнай катэгорыі пашырэнняў. Напрыклад, спачатку будуць пералічаны файлы без пашырэнняў (у літарна-лічбавым парадку), а затым файлы з пашырэннямі, як . 1, . bz2, .

Што такое каманда для сартавання файлаў па памеры файла?

Вам трэба перадаць опцыю -S або –sort=size наступным чынам у камандны радок Linux або Unix: $ ls -S. $ ls -S -l. $ ls –сартаваць=памер -l.

Як сартаваць файлы?

Каб адсартаваць файлы ў іншым парадку, націсніце адзін з загалоўкаў слупкоў у файлавым менеджэр. Напрыклад, націсніце Тып, каб адсартаваць па тыпу файла. Пстрыкніце загаловак слупка яшчэ раз, каб сартаваць у адваротным парадку. У праглядзе спісу вы можаце паказаць слупкі з большай колькасцю атрыбутаў і сартаваць па гэтых слупках.

Як пералічыць усе каталогі ў Linux?

Глядзіце наступныя прыклады:

  1. Каб вывесці спіс усіх файлаў у бягучым каталогу, увядзіце наступнае: ls -a Гэта спіс усіх файлаў, у тым ліку. кропка (.) …
  2. Каб паказаць падрабязную інфармацыю, увядзіце наступнае: ls -l chap1 .profile. …
  3. Каб паказаць падрабязную інфармацыю аб каталогу, увядзіце наступнае: ls -d -l .

Як вы сартуеце лік у Linux?

Сартаваць па нумар перадаць опцыю -n для сартавання . Гэта будзе сартаваць ад самага малога да найбольшага і запісаць вынік у стандартны вывад. Выкажам здагадку, што існуе файл са спісам прадметаў адзення, які мае нумар у пачатку радка і павінен быць адсартаваны ў ліках. Файл захаваны як адзенне.

Як пералічыць 10 лепшых файлаў у Linux?

Крокі, каб знайсці найбуйнейшыя каталогі ў Linux

дзю камандаваць : Ацэнка выкарыстання файлавай прасторы. каманда сартавання : Сартаванне радкоў тэкставых файлаў або дадзеных уводных дадзеных. head command : вывесці першую частку файлаў, г.зн. для адлюстравання першых 10 самых вялікіх файлаў. каманда пошуку: Пошук файла.

Як выкарыстоўваць find у Linux?

Каманда знайсці выкарыстоўваецца для пошуку і знайдзіце спіс файлаў і каталогаў на аснове ўмоў, якія вы задаеце для файлаў, якія адпавядаюць аргументам. Каманда find можа выкарыстоўвацца ў розных умовах, напрыклад, вы можаце знайсці файлы па дазволах, карыстальнікам, групам, тыпах файлаў, даце, памеры і іншым магчымым крытэрам.

Як знайсці апошнія 10 файлаў у UNIX?

Гэта дадатак да галоўнай каманды. The каманда хваста, як вынікае з назвы, надрукаваць апошнюю N колькасць дадзеных дадзенага ўводу. Па змаўчанні ён друкуе апошнія 10 радкоў названых файлаў. Калі ўказана больш чым адна назва файла, перад дадзенымі з кожнага файла стаіць яго імя.

Падабаецца гэты пост? Калі ласка, падзяліцеся з сябрамі:
АС сёння